Problems solved by technology

At present, the overcurrent detection of high-current power devices is most commonly implemented using the Hall current sensor solution. However, the temperature drift of the Hall sensor is relatively serious, and the price is high, and there are specific requirements for the location and layout of the sensor.

Abstract

The invention provides a positive temperature coefficient (PTC) water heater over-current detection software and hardware dual protection circuit which is high in sampling precision, short in response time, capable of providing dual protection for software and hardware and low in requirement for printed circuit board (PCB) Layout. The PTC water heater over-current detection software and hardware dual protection circuit comprises a constantan wire sampling resistor with the precision being one percent, and the constantan wire sampling resistor transfers a current signal into a voltage signal which is sent to an amplifying circuit composed of U1B, R13, R15, R16 and C4. The signal which is amplified by 1+R16 / R15 times is sent to a comparator circuit composed of U1A, U2, R12, R15, R16 and C3. When the voltage is higher than a fiducial voltage stabilizing value (VCC / 2), a comparator outputs a saturation VCC voltage, and the output VCC voltage is fed back to the in-phase end of the operational amplifier U1A through D3 and R7, and thus the comparator is in a state that the saturation voltage VCC is output forwards in a self-locking mode. An audion Q3 is electrified through the output voltage, and then pins can be pulled down through an insulated gate bipolar transistor (IGBT) driving module, so that an IGBT is closed.

Background technique [0002] PTC is the abbreviation of PositiveTemperatureCoefficient, which means a positive temperature coefficient, and generally refers to semiconductor materials or components with a large positive temperature coefficient. As a new type of thermistor material, its main application can be divided into two categories: switching and heating. Utilizing the characteristics of heating PTC, such as stable performance, rapid temperature rise, and little influence from power supply voltage fluctuations, various heater products have become the most ideal substitute products for metal resistance wire heating materials.
